What NOT to do in your server room

Leave unused cables in-place. Do not use cable management. Label no cables.

Use cables of inappropriate length (this is a SCSI cable!):
Plug your most critical servers and SAN into a small stand-alone UPS instead of the large, redundant, UPS battery backup:
Keep old and dead equipment in the rack:

Use the aisle in front of your server racks for old PC storage:

Run cables through unusual pathways that require un-racking servers to move a cable:
Stack equipment back-to-back and resting on top of each other:
